Output e13877a0a95d46c1e8d33c8c0ccef8cf73eec7b3929d32635a78dd05efcdb738:22

value
6094455
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c5395479ff82df41de4fffdeb8b5f50d0a009c9 OP_EQUAL
address
32pCAJXY18nkWYXvAX6mSyhek7PuaZazCd
transaction
e13877a0a95d46c1e8d33c8c0ccef8cf73eec7b3929d32635a78dd05efcdb738
spent
true